ICD-10: M05.462

Rheumatoid myopathy with rheumatoid arthritis of left knee

Additional Information

Description

ICD-10 code M05.462 refers to "Rheumatoid myopathy with rheumatoid arthritis of the left knee." This code is part of the broader classification of rheumatoid arthritis (RA) and its associated complications, specifically focusing on the muscular involvement that can occur in conjunction with joint inflammation.

Clinical Description

Rheumatoid Arthritis (RA)

Rheumatoid arthritis is a chronic inflammatory disorder that primarily affects the joints, leading to pain, swelling, and potential joint damage. It is an autoimmune condition where the immune system mistakenly attacks the synovium—the lining of the membranes that surround the joints. Over time, this can result in joint erosion and deformity.

Rheumatoid Myopathy

Rheumatoid myopathy is a condition characterized by muscle weakness and pain associated with rheumatoid arthritis. It can manifest as a result of the systemic effects of RA, including inflammation and the impact of chronic pain on muscle function. Patients may experience muscle weakness, particularly in the proximal muscles, which can significantly affect mobility and quality of life.

Specifics of M05.462

The designation of M05.462 indicates that the patient has rheumatoid myopathy specifically linked to rheumatoid arthritis affecting the left knee. This suggests that the inflammatory processes associated with RA are not only impacting the joint but also leading to muscular complications in the vicinity of the affected knee.

Clinical Features

  • Symptoms: Patients may report localized pain in the left knee, swelling, and stiffness, particularly after periods of inactivity. Muscle weakness may also be noted, particularly in the quadriceps and hamstring muscles surrounding the knee.
  • Physical Examination: On examination, there may be tenderness and swelling in the left knee joint, along with reduced range of motion. Muscle strength testing may reveal weakness in the muscles that support the knee.
  • Diagnostic Tests: Diagnosis typically involves a combination of clinical evaluation, imaging studies (such as X-rays or MRI), and laboratory tests to assess inflammatory markers and the presence of rheumatoid factor or anti-citrullinated protein antibodies (ACPAs).

Treatment Considerations

Management of M05.462 involves addressing both the rheumatoid arthritis and the associated myopathy. Treatment strategies may include:

  • Medications: Disease-modifying antirheumatic drugs (DMARDs) such as methotrexate, biologics like TNF inhibitors, and corticosteroids to reduce inflammation and manage symptoms.
  • Physical Therapy: Rehabilitation exercises to improve muscle strength and joint function, focusing on the left knee and surrounding musculature.
  • Pain Management: Nonsteroidal anti-inflammatory drugs (NSAIDs) or other analgesics to alleviate pain and improve the patient's quality of life.

Clinical Information

Rheumatoid myopathy, particularly in the context of rheumatoid arthritis (RA), presents a unique set of clinical features and patient characteristics. The ICD-10 code M05.462 specifically refers to rheumatoid myopathy associated with rheumatoid arthritis affecting the left knee. Below is a detailed overview of the clinical presentation, signs, symptoms, and patient characteristics associated with this condition.

Clinical Presentation

Overview of Rheumatoid Myopathy

Rheumatoid myopathy is characterized by muscle weakness and pain that occurs in conjunction with rheumatoid arthritis. It is important to note that while rheumatoid arthritis primarily affects the joints, it can also lead to systemic manifestations, including muscle involvement.

Signs and Symptoms

  1. Muscle Weakness: Patients often experience proximal muscle weakness, which may affect the shoulders, hips, and thighs. This weakness can lead to difficulties in performing daily activities, such as climbing stairs or lifting objects.

  2. Muscle Pain: Myalgia (muscle pain) is common and can be diffuse or localized. Patients may report tenderness in the affected muscles.

  3. Joint Symptoms: Since the condition is associated with rheumatoid arthritis, patients typically exhibit:
    - Swelling and tenderness in the left knee joint.
    - Morning stiffness lasting more than 30 minutes.
    - Symmetrical joint involvement, often affecting multiple joints.

  4. Fatigue: Chronic fatigue is a prevalent symptom in patients with rheumatoid arthritis and can be exacerbated by muscle weakness and pain.

  5. Systemic Symptoms: Patients may also experience systemic symptoms such as low-grade fever, malaise, and weight loss, which are common in inflammatory conditions.

Patient Characteristics

  1. Demographics:
    - Age: Rheumatoid arthritis typically presents in middle-aged adults, with a peak onset between 30 and 60 years of age.
    - Gender: Women are more frequently affected than men, with a ratio of approximately 3:1.

  2. Medical History:
    - A history of rheumatoid arthritis is essential, as the myopathy is a complication of this underlying condition.
    - Patients may have a history of other autoimmune diseases or comorbidities.

  3. Physical Examination Findings:
    - On examination, the left knee may show signs of inflammation, including warmth, swelling, and decreased range of motion.
    - Muscle strength testing may reveal weakness in proximal muscle groups, particularly in the upper arms and thighs.

  4. Laboratory Findings:
    - Elevated inflammatory markers (e.g., ESR, CRP) are common.
    - Rheumatoid factor (RF) and anti-citrullinated protein antibodies (ACPA) may be present, confirming the diagnosis of rheumatoid arthritis.

  5. Imaging Studies:
    - MRI or ultrasound may be utilized to assess joint inflammation and muscle involvement, revealing edema or atrophy in affected muscles.

Diagnostic Criteria

To diagnose rheumatoid myopathy associated with rheumatoid arthritis, particularly for the ICD-10 code M05.462, healthcare providers typically follow a set of established criteria. These criteria encompass clinical evaluations, laboratory tests, and imaging studies to ensure an accurate diagnosis. Below is a detailed overview of the criteria used for this diagnosis.

Clinical Criteria

  1. Symptoms of Rheumatoid Arthritis (RA):
    - Patients must exhibit typical symptoms of RA, which include joint pain, swelling, and stiffness, particularly in the morning or after periods of inactivity. The presence of these symptoms in the left knee is crucial for the diagnosis of M05.462.

  2. Muscle Weakness:
    - Rheumatoid myopathy is characterized by muscle weakness, which may be generalized or localized. The weakness is often more pronounced in proximal muscles, affecting the ability to perform daily activities.

  3. Duration of Symptoms:
    - Symptoms should persist for a minimum duration, typically at least six weeks, to differentiate chronic conditions from acute inflammatory processes.

Laboratory Criteria

  1. Serological Tests:
    - Positive rheumatoid factor (RF) and anti-citrullinated protein antibodies (ACPA) are significant indicators of rheumatoid arthritis. Elevated levels of these antibodies support the diagnosis of RA and, by extension, rheumatoid myopathy.

  2. Inflammatory Markers:
    - Blood tests showing elevated levels of inflammatory markers such as C-reactive protein (CRP) and erythrocyte sedimentation rate (ESR) can indicate active inflammation associated with rheumatoid arthritis.

  3. Creatine Kinase (CK) Levels:
    - Elevated CK levels may suggest muscle damage or myopathy. This test helps differentiate between rheumatoid myopathy and other forms of muscle weakness.

Imaging Studies

  1. X-rays:
    - X-rays of the affected knee can reveal joint damage, erosions, or other changes consistent with rheumatoid arthritis. This imaging is essential to assess the extent of joint involvement.

  2. MRI or Ultrasound:
    - Advanced imaging techniques like MRI or ultrasound may be utilized to evaluate soft tissue involvement, synovitis, and muscle inflammation, providing a clearer picture of the extent of myopathy.

Exclusion of Other Conditions

  1. Differential Diagnosis:
    - It is crucial to rule out other potential causes of muscle weakness and joint pain, such as other autoimmune diseases, infections, or metabolic disorders. A thorough clinical history and examination are necessary to exclude these conditions.

  2. Response to Treatment:
    - Observing the patient's response to corticosteroids or disease-modifying antirheumatic drugs (DMARDs) can also provide insight into the diagnosis. Improvement in symptoms with treatment may support the diagnosis of rheumatoid myopathy.

Treatment Guidelines

Rheumatoid myopathy, particularly in the context of rheumatoid arthritis (RA) affecting the left knee, presents a complex clinical picture that requires a multifaceted treatment approach. The ICD-10 code M05.462 specifically denotes rheumatoid myopathy associated with rheumatoid arthritis, which can lead to muscle weakness and functional impairment. Below is a detailed overview of standard treatment approaches for this condition.

Understanding Rheumatoid Myopathy

Rheumatoid myopathy is characterized by muscle weakness and inflammation associated with rheumatoid arthritis. Patients may experience symptoms such as fatigue, muscle pain, and decreased mobility, particularly in the affected joints, such as the left knee in this case. The treatment aims to manage inflammation, alleviate pain, and improve overall function.

Standard Treatment Approaches

1. Pharmacological Interventions

a. Disease-Modifying Antirheumatic Drugs (DMARDs)

DMARDs are essential in managing rheumatoid arthritis and can help control the underlying disease process. Commonly used DMARDs include:
- Methotrexate: Often the first-line treatment for RA, it helps reduce inflammation and slow disease progression.
- Leflunomide: Another DMARD that can be used in patients who do not respond to methotrexate.

b. Biologic Agents

For patients with moderate to severe RA, biologic agents may be indicated. These include:
- Tumor Necrosis Factor (TNF) Inhibitors: Such as Infliximab (Remicade) and Etanercept (Enbrel), which target specific pathways in the inflammatory process.
- Interleukin-6 (IL-6) Inhibitors: Like Tocilizumab (Actemra), which can be particularly effective in managing systemic inflammation.

c. Corticosteroids

Corticosteroids, such as prednisone, may be prescribed for short-term management of acute inflammation and pain relief. They can help reduce muscle inflammation associated with myopathy.

d. Nonsteroidal Anti-Inflammatory Drugs (NSAIDs)

NSAIDs can be used to manage pain and inflammation. Common options include ibuprofen and naproxen.

2. Physical Therapy and Rehabilitation

Physical therapy plays a crucial role in the management of rheumatoid myopathy. A tailored rehabilitation program may include:
- Strengthening Exercises: To improve muscle strength and function, particularly around the affected knee.
- Range of Motion Exercises: To maintain joint flexibility and prevent stiffness.
- Aerobic Conditioning: To enhance overall fitness and endurance, which can be beneficial for managing fatigue.

3. Occupational Therapy

Occupational therapy can assist patients in adapting their daily activities to accommodate their physical limitations. This may involve:
- Assistive Devices: Such as knee braces or orthotics to support the knee joint.
- Activity Modification: Strategies to reduce strain on the affected knee during daily tasks.

4. Lifestyle Modifications

Encouraging patients to adopt a healthy lifestyle can significantly impact their overall well-being. Recommendations may include:
- Balanced Diet: Emphasizing anti-inflammatory foods, such as omega-3 fatty acids, fruits, and vegetables.
- Regular Exercise: Engaging in low-impact activities like swimming or cycling to maintain joint health without exacerbating symptoms.
- Weight Management: Maintaining a healthy weight to reduce stress on the knee joint.

5. Monitoring and Follow-Up

Regular follow-up appointments are essential to monitor disease progression and treatment efficacy. Adjustments to the treatment plan may be necessary based on the patient's response and any side effects experienced.
